They do have the legal right to request asylum and to make their case. That right is enshrined in US Law. They are entitled to legally apply for asylum if they fear for their lives if they return to their native countries.

They are looking for safety for themselves and their children. They should complete the requisite paperwork and get the process going.

You know, while the caravan IS at the border, none of them are entering "illegally". They are lining up at the border entrance station and are waiting to see if they can be processed for asylum.

The hold up is coming because the BP says that they don't have enough people to process all of them and that the system is "at full capacity" at this time.

They are camping out on the Mexican side of the border while they are waiting to be processed.
